My sat nav and cd changer are saying no discs when they have discs in them can't work it out any help would be much appreciated.

Does it accept and eject as normal? If it does then throw a cleaning-disc in, might work, might not :unsure:

Is it damp in the boot area? If yes, chances are it'll be buggered... Use a hair dryer ;)

Does your Sat Nav have the right disc? Mk1.2.3 are CD Mk4 DVD? With the CD Changer check the cartridge is the right one and the discs are in correctly. When you load the CD cartridge in the boot you should hear it cycle the first disc.

  • 4 weeks later...

I have the same problem,mk 4 disc,dvd insert the disc,comes up no disc,same with cd player,load up the discs comes up no disc must be a fault with these things

First check that the disc is a BMW OEM disc these can be temperamental. Have you tried the "disconnect battery for 30mins" trick this resets everything and has fixed many strange gremlins plus make sure your battery is fully charged.

If all else fails you may have failed laser head, not unheard of. You can buy a laser head replacement if you want to DIY or send the unit off for repair if not. Either is cheaper than a replacement.
